Mary Hallock Foote’s novel, ‘The Desert and the Sown’, beautifully captures the struggles of American women in the late 19th century as they navigate the harsh realities of the Wild West. Through vivid descriptions and compelling characters, Foote paints a vivid picture of the rugged landscape and the challenges faced by pioneers. Her writing style is delicate yet powerful, immersing the reader in a world of hardship and resilience. This work is a valuable contribution to American literature, showcasing the experiences of women in a historical context. Foote’s attention to detail and ability to evoke emotion make ‘The Desert and the Sown’ a compelling read. Mary Hallock Foote’s own experiences as a Western pioneer inform her writing, bringing an authenticity and depth to the narrative. Her unique perspective offers insight into the lives of women during a tumultuous period of American history.
